The general rule is that an individual is an independent contractor if the payer has the right to control or direct only the result of the work, not what will be done and how it will be done. Small businesses should consider all evidence of the degree of control and independence in the employer/worker relationship. An agency contractor is someone who agrees to fulfill a pre-defined project for the agency’s client in exchange for compensation. Generally, the individual is a W-2 hourly employee of the agency but is working onsite for the client. Paychecks and benefits will come from the agency. All employer taxes are also paid by the agency.

Classifying a worker as an employee or an independent contractor has a significant effect on the cost of employing that individual. For this reason, the IRS and Department of Labor pay close attention to worker classification issues to ensure that employers are making the right determinations. While the independent contractor is his or her own boss, work stays within the definitions of oral or written contract and adheres to certain requirements. An employee, on the other hand, relies on the business for steady income, gives up elements of control and independence, is eligible for certain benefits and works within constraint of workplace.
The General Contractor is usually an individual or company that manages the day-to-day activities at the jobsite. They are the lead entity in charge of actually building the building. They have their own employees who serve as project manager or foreman with laborers who self-perform on projects or utilize a variety of specialty subcontractors.

So familiar is the concept of contra-charging that it is often accepted that the deduction, a form of set-off, is simply part of the account assessment process. The employer or main contractor assumes a right to set-off their contra-charges; the contractor or sub-contractor assumes that they are permitted.
